WebThe validation criteria for Module 10B is to know and demonstrate (or instruct a trainer) your skill in performing the following: a) approach to and assessment of scene / incident; b) CPR for an adult; c) CPR for a child. I have a current First Aid certificate – do I still need to do 1st Response? Possibly not. WebIf the validation criteria are met, your Training Adviser will let you know and update your Compass record.
